The Emirates Group reaffirmed its commitment to environmental responsibility and reducing plastic pollution through its flagship sustainability showcase, Tomorrow Takes Flight. The annual event brought together Emirates and dnata staff and industry partners to spotlight wide-ranging initiatives that align with the United Nations’ 2025 theme to #BeatPlasticPollution. Hosted in Dubai, the exhibition highlighted how the Emirates Group is embedding sustainability into its operations, from engineering and cargo to catering, travel and service delivery. Ooredoo is once again offering mobile users the chance to claim a unique piece of digital identity as it launches its fifth Vanity Number Auction of 2025, with registration set to open on 7 July at 9am. The auction presents an exclusive opportunity for customers to bid on premium Gold and Diamond numbers, offering a personalised touch to their mobile presence. The registration window will remain open for 24 hours, followed by a six-hour bidding session on 8 July, starting at 9am. ENOC Group, the UAE’s leading integrated energy player, has appointed Mr. Hussain Sultan Lootah as Acting Chief Executive Officer, marking a new chapter in its leadership as the organisation continues to align with Dubai’s ambitions for sustainable development and economic diversification. Mr. Lootah succeeds Mr. Saif Humaid Al Falasi, who served as Group CEO for the past decade, steering ENOC through a period of expansion, innovation, and transformation in the regional energy sector. A global phase 3 clinical trial led by the American University of Beirut (AUB) and Lebanon’s Chronic Care Center has shown that mitapivat, an oral therapy, significantly improves outcomes in non-transfusion-dependent thalassemia (NTDT) — marking a historic shift in the treatment of the lifelong blood disorder. The findings, published in The Lancet, one of the world’s leading medical journals, demonstrate the first successful results of an oral, disease-modifying therapy for both alpha- and beta-thalassemia forms of NTDT. In a first-of-its-kind seminar at Georgetown University in Qatar (GU-Q), Dr. Maryam Mohamed Alsada, Postdoctoral Fellow and alumna, is leading a critical effort to reframe how Gulf women’s lives are documented, remembered, and taught. The summer course, titled Documenting Gulf Women, invites students to explore the politics of historical knowledge through creative and culturally grounded research methods. Designed around site-based learning and oral history, the course provides students with tools to engage Gulf women’s lived experiences beyond traditional academic boundaries. The National Youth Orchestra of Dubai (NYO–Dubai) made history this week by becoming the first orchestra from the UAE to perform at New York’s iconic Carnegie Hall, a momentous achievement supported by the Dubai Culture and Arts Authority. The landmark performance, funded under the Dubai Cultural Grant programme as part of the Dubai Quality of Life Strategy, highlights the emirate’s growing global stature in the creative arts and its commitment to fostering young musical talent. Wizz Air has been ranked the world’s most emissions-efficient airline, according to new data released by aviation analytics firm Cirium. The Hungary-based low-cost carrier recorded an industry-low 53.9 grams of CO₂ per Available Seat Kilometer (ASK) in Cirium’s inaugural Flight Emissions Review, released today. The annual review offers the first verified global benchmark for airline emissions, enabling fair comparisons across the aviation sector as it works towards Net Zero by 2050 targets. Maserati enjoyed a triumphant weekend at the iconic Spa-Francorchamps circuit, clinching a win in the Am Cup class and multiple podiums across categories in Round 3 of the 2025 GT2 European Series Powered by Pirelli. In Race 1, the spotlight was firmly on Philippe Prette, who secured a commanding class victory from pole position in the Am Cup. Driving the number 1 Maserati GT2 for LP Racing, Prette built an early lead and expertly navigated the rain-slicked track to secure his fourth win of the season in class.
